CNC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

425 of the 3,711 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Centene (CNC)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$8.95B — up 12% from $8.02B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 86 funds opened new CNC positions and 41 closed out — a net gain of 45 holders — while 155 added to existing stakes and 150 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Acadian Asset Management, adding an estimated $89.3M. The largest seller was Jennison Associates, cutting an estimated $84.2M.
